What to Consider When Buying a Used Mobile Home
Purchasing a used mobile home requires careful consideration of several factors. First, it’s essential to assess the condition of the home. Inspect the structure for signs of wear and tear, such as leaks, rust, or damage to the exterior. A professional inspection can provide a thorough evaluation of the home’s condition.
Location is another critical factor. Consider the community where the mobile home is located, including amenities, accessibility to services, and local regulations. It’s also important to review the terms of the land lease if the mobile home is on rented land, as this can impact long-term costs and obligations.
Lastly, consider financing options. While mobile homes are generally more affordable, securing financing for a used model can be challenging. Exploring different lenders and understanding the terms can help in making an informed decision.
Steps to Buying a Used Mobile Home
The process of purchasing a used mobile home involves several steps. First, establish a budget. This will guide the selection process and ensure affordability. Next, begin the search for available homes. Online listings, local real estate agents, and mobile home communities are excellent resources for finding potential options.
Once a suitable home is found, conduct a thorough inspection. This step is crucial to identify any potential issues that could require repairs or maintenance. If the home meets expectations, negotiate the price with the seller, keeping in mind the condition and market value of similar homes.
Finally, complete the necessary paperwork and secure financing if needed. This includes signing a purchase agreement, transferring the title, and arranging for insurance. Ensuring all documentation is in order will facilitate a smooth transition to homeownership.
